What Happened to Braxton Berrios?
The incident that led to the Braxton Berrios injury happened during a game against the Indianapolis Colts. It was Sunday, October 20, during Week 7 of the 2024 season, when the Dolphins were playing a tough match. Berrios, who is usually quite agile and quick, was involved in a play that caused immediate concern among those watching. It was a moment that, you know, seemed to halt the action and bring a collective gasp from the crowd, if you will.
Reports from the field suggested that he left the game with what was thought to be a serious knee issue. His agent, Drew Rosenhaus, was quick to share some initial thoughts with Miami sportscaster Josh Moser, indicating that the team's punt and kick returner would need to get an MRI on his knee very soon. How Severe Was Braxton Berrios' Injury?
The initial concerns about the Braxton Berrios injury turned out to be, sadly, quite accurate. Doctors confirmed that he had suffered a torn ACL, which is a major knee problem for any athlete, particularly one whose game relies so much on quick movements and sudden stops. This kind of diagnosis, you know, means a long period away from the field, as it typically requires surgery and a lengthy recovery process.
The torn ACL meant that Berrios's season came to an early and rather abrupt end. This kind of news is always a tough pill to swallow for a player who loves to compete and contribute to their team. It's not just about missing games; it’s about the hard work that goes into getting back to full strength, and that's a very, very real challenge for anyone in his shoes.
Nick Pugliese of the Palm Beach Post reported on the specifics of the left knee injury, making it clear that it was indeed an ACL tear. This information, once it became public, truly solidified the severity of the Braxton Berrios injury and what it would mean for the Dolphins' plans moving forward. What Was the Immediate Aftermath of Braxton Berrios' Injury?
Following the game where the Braxton Berrios injury happened, the steps taken were pretty standard for such a serious situation. Berrios was scheduled for an MRI on the Monday right after the Sunday game, which is a common practice to get a full picture of the damage. His agent, Drew Rosenhaus, had shared that there was a strong worry that it could be a significant knee problem, and that worry, as we now know, was well-founded.
Just eleven days after the injury, Berrios had to make a choice to undergo surgery to fix his torn ACL. This kind of procedure is, you know, a big step on the road to getting better, and it marks the beginning of the rehabilitation journey. It’s a decision that, honestly, no athlete wants to make, but it’s often necessary to ensure a proper recovery and a chance to play again.
The Dolphins also made a move to place Berrios on injured reserve, as reported by Cameron Wolfe of NFL Network. This action, basically, frees up a spot on the team's active roster while the player recovers from their injury. It's a procedural step, but it also signals the team's acceptance that the player will be out for an extended period, which for the Braxton Berrios injury, meant the rest of the season, unfortunately.
What Does This Mean for Braxton Berrios' Future?
Looking ahead, the Braxton Berrios injury introduces some interesting questions about his career path. On top of dealing with a major physical setback, Berrios is also set to become a free agent in 2025. This means that once his current contract ends, he'll be able to sign with any team, but the timing of a serious injury like an ACL tear can make that process a bit more complicated.
